static void xyz12Torgb48(struct SwsContext *c, uint16_t *dst,
const uint16_t *src, int stride, int h)
{
int xp,yp;
const AVPixFmtDescriptor *desc = av_pix_fmt_desc_get(c->srcFormat);
for (yp=0; yp<h; yp++) {
for (xp=0; xp+2<stride; xp+=3) {
int x, y, z, r, g, b;
if (desc->flags & PIX_FMT_BE) {
x = AV_RB16(src + xp + 0);
y = AV_RB16(src + xp + 1);
z = AV_RB16(src + xp + 2);
} else {
x = AV_RL16(src + xp + 0);
y = AV_RL16(src + xp + 1);
z = AV_RL16(src + xp + 2);
}
x = c->xyzgamma[x>>4];
y = c->xyzgamma[y>>4];
z = c->xyzgamma[z>>4];
// convert from XYZlinear to sRGBlinear
r = c->xyz2rgb_matrix[0][0] * x +
c->xyz2rgb_matrix[0][1] * y +
c->xyz2rgb_matrix[0][2] * z >> 12;
g = c->xyz2rgb_matrix[1][0] * x +
c->xyz2rgb_matrix[1][1] * y +
c->xyz2rgb_matrix[1][2] * z >> 12;
b = c->xyz2rgb_matrix[2][0] * x +
c->xyz2rgb_matrix[1][2] * y +
c->xyz2rgb_matrix[2][2] * z >> 12;
// limit values to 12-bit depth
r = av_clip_c(r,0,4095);
g = av_clip_c(g,0,4095);
b = av_clip_c(b,0,4095);
// convert from sRGBlinear to RGB and scale from 12bit to 16bit
if (desc->flags & PIX_FMT_BE) {
AV_WB16(dst + xp + 0, c->rgbgamma[r] << 4);
AV_WB16(dst + xp + 1, c->rgbgamma[g] << 4);
AV_WB16(dst + xp + 2, c->rgbgamma[b] << 4);
} else {
AV_WL16(dst + xp + 0, c->rgbgamma[r] << 4);
AV_WL16(dst + xp + 1, c->rgbgamma[g] << 4);
AV_WL16(dst + xp + 2, c->rgbgamma[b] << 4);
}
}
src += stride;
dst += stride;
}
}
